At the Kinney Middle, all contributors consider that kids study best when classes experience fewer like operate and far more like entertaining.

Recreational systems like Camp Kinney integrate movement pursuits, staff-constructing, and online games to aid development towards building social abilities via purpose-location.

Camp Kinney’s reverse inclusion product has been perfected about the earlier 9 decades, and is accredited by the American Camp Affiliation.

Kids take part in a selection of pursuits equivalent to a conventional summer time camp, whilst also getting a naturalistic application of Utilized Habits Examination (ABA).

Each and every week, campers splash in the pool, set up “wild and wacky” science experiments and generate performs of artwork, whilst working to a personalised set of aims.

Weekly visits by particular attendees involve martial arts practitioners, zookeepers from a petting zoo, researchers, musicians and sing-alongside things to do, and many far more.

For summertime 2021, the Kinney Middle for Autism Education and learning and Guidance held its ninth Camp Kinney, an accredited camp which is open up to children with Autism Spectrum Condition (ASD) and to their neurotypical peers.

Take note: Kinney Students are existing undergraduate students who, prior to the get started of Camp, receive 2 months of intensive teaching, which include particular coaching on their person camper’s conduct approach and/or IEP.

Students are supervised by potential actions analysts and medical gurus via the Graduate Assistant staff, which include Board Licensed Assistant Behavior Analysts (BCABA).

Every camp team is overseen by a software director from the Kinney Center’s full time workers of BCBAs who will aid schooling, conduct management, and each day supervision of each camper’s personalized plans.
